A quick color theory lesson with help from ‘A Dictionary of Color Combinations’ 🧡
Analogous colors are colors that are adjacent on the color wheel. Orange-yellow, red-orange, & violet are adjacent on the color wheel, making them analogous colors. This creates a cohesive & visually pleasing combination.
Some pointers on how to style these colors:
✨Combine orange-yellow & violet for a harmonious yet contrasting look. The warm tones of orange-yellow complement the cool hues of violet, creating a vibrant ensemble.
✨Use the colors in varying proportions to create balance. Use 1 color as the dominant shade & the others as accents to avoid overwhelming the outfit.
